Output 6f15a6184d25934177842f7bf218832421c3b4a2ed43b5bdaaf491b188f303d0:1

value
1305660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a76f6bf6306886d7563f8304b1a3eb89d5cf721 OP_EQUAL
address
3EK9gmcsqnzdNfJrwfbt7K4BRmhVCG1BMA
transaction
6f15a6184d25934177842f7bf218832421c3b4a2ed43b5bdaaf491b188f303d0
spent
true